Above:The scene of Alfred Bonenfant's fatal accident on Rue Du Pont (Bridge Street) about 20 years later. A streetcar is stopped at the terminus on the track that looped south from Rue Principale. The Ottawa House is at left under the Brading's Ale sign. The brown and yellow building is the Banque de Montréal, built in 1907. Below: Another photo taken sometime after 1907. The camera is at ground level and south of the Banque de Montréal (in the centre of the photo). A streetcar on the other side of the Rue Du Pont loop is passing the E.B. Eddy Co. office building, just where Alfred Bonenfant was struck by his cab. The Ottawa House is at the left edge of the picture. |
